Yes I've used it and have had much success with it. I have before and after pictures of using it on my mare with ulcers on the pyloric region. Night and day difference in just 4 weeks. It was recommended to me by the internal medicine vet that developed this product. If you'd like the pictures message me your email and I will send them to you or I can show you on my Facebook.

ETA - This is the only treatment she was on for the ulcers. I never used omeprazole, ranitidine, or sucralfate. After the last appointment and gastroscope I lowered her dosage on the ReLyne and started adding aloe vera juice. I've read good things on Papaya enzymes so I'm going to start adding that as well.
